The FitzGeralds also arrived this evening.  Unlike the Brewers, our biggest delay was at the Flying J where all but three fuel lines were shut down for some unknown reason.  Inside they also were having problems with their receipt printers so everyone was trying to fix that problem and waits for purchases were lengthy.  We had made good time until then and decided to keep going thinking we would still arrive at Catalina in daylight.  NOT!  Just as we left I-10 on Tangerine the sun was setting and it was mostly dark on Tangerine.  This is a good two-lane road, max. 50 mph, and with many dips at 35 mph.  It's well-traveled and a good route from the west.  Tangerine deadends at Oracle.  Our GPS said to turn left onto Oracle, which is wrong.  There is a small sign at the Oracle intersection that says Catalina SP is to the right.  You turn right and go about one mile to the first taffiic light.  On the right is a big shopping center (something Marketplace) and you turn left at that light onto an unmarked road.  Once you make the turn you see the entrance sign that says Catalina State Park.  When we got to the ranger station he was just closing up but gave Jerry a map so we could find campground B.  Boy, it was a dark drive in but we immediately saw Russ' coach and Ken came out to guide us around and into a pull-though site.  It was for us a long day but we're glad we're once again among our framily!
